Don, We ripped down 1400 buckets today. Little to no sap in the buckets. the buckets that had sap in them were filled with millers, flies, and spiders, and the sap was either yellow or milky, so we dumped the sap on the ground. The woods is bone dry. Tomarrow we will tare down the last 750 buckets and boil off the evaporators. Then we have to wash all the buckets and evaporator pans, and hope for a better 2015. The uncles started planting oats yesterday and the dust is flying. We delayed pulling the buckets last week hopeing the cold weather would induce another run, but there is no moisture in the ground and the 3"of snow we got, did nothing to produce more sap. The trees have No buds on them yet. It's been a strange and disapointing year, for sure. Loren
